虚拟网络流量采集的数据分析方法
在当今信息化时代,虚拟网络已经成为人们生活中不可或缺的一部分。随着网络技术的不断发展,虚拟网络流量采集的数据分析方法也日益成为研究热点。本文将从虚拟网络流量采集的数据分析方法入手,探讨其应用场景、技术要点以及在实际案例中的应用。
一、虚拟网络流量采集的数据分析方法概述
1. 虚拟网络流量采集
虚拟网络流量采集是指通过采集网络中的数据包,获取网络流量信息的过程。采集的数据包括数据包的源地址、目的地址、端口、协议类型、传输时间等。虚拟网络流量采集是网络安全、网络优化、网络监控等领域的重要基础。
2. 数据分析方法
虚拟网络流量采集的数据分析方法主要包括以下几种:
- 统计分析法:通过对采集到的数据进行统计分析,发现数据中的规律和趋势,如流量分布、协议使用情况等。
- 聚类分析法:将具有相似特征的流量数据进行分组,便于后续分析。
- 关联规则挖掘法:挖掘数据中的关联规则,发现数据之间的潜在关系。
- 异常检测法:检测数据中的异常情况,如恶意流量、异常访问等。
二、虚拟网络流量采集的数据分析方法应用场景
1. 网络安全
虚拟网络流量采集的数据分析方法可以用于网络安全领域,如:
- 入侵检测:通过分析网络流量,发现恶意攻击行为。
- 恶意代码检测:检测网络流量中的恶意代码,防止其传播。
- 安全事件响应:分析安全事件,为应急响应提供依据。
2. 网络优化
虚拟网络流量采集的数据分析方法可以用于网络优化领域,如:
- 流量分析:分析网络流量分布,优化网络资源配置。
- 性能分析:分析网络性能指标,发现瓶颈,进行优化。
- 故障排查:分析网络故障原因,定位故障点。
3. 网络监控
虚拟网络流量采集的数据分析方法可以用于网络监控领域,如:
- 流量监控:实时监控网络流量,发现异常情况。
- 性能监控:监控网络性能指标,确保网络稳定运行。
- 安全监控:监控网络安全事件,保障网络安全。
三、虚拟网络流量采集的数据分析方法技术要点
1. 数据采集
- 数据采集工具:选择合适的网络流量采集工具,如Wireshark、Pcap等。
- 数据采集方式:根据需求选择合适的采集方式,如实时采集、离线采集等。
- 数据采集范围:确定采集的数据范围,如指定IP地址、端口、协议等。
2. 数据处理
- 数据清洗:去除无效、错误的数据,保证数据质量。
- 数据转换:将原始数据转换为便于分析的数据格式。
- 数据存储:将处理后的数据存储到数据库或文件中。
3. 数据分析
- 选择合适的分析方法:根据需求选择合适的分析方法,如统计分析、聚类分析等。
- 数据可视化:将分析结果以图表、图形等形式展示,便于理解和分析。
- 结果评估:对分析结果进行评估,确保分析结果的准确性。
四、案例分析
1. 恶意流量检测
假设某企业发现网络流量异常,通过虚拟网络流量采集的数据分析方法,发现恶意流量主要集中在某个IP地址。通过进一步分析,发现该IP地址属于境外恶意攻击者,企业及时采取措施,防止了恶意攻击。
2. 网络性能优化
某企业通过虚拟网络流量采集的数据分析方法,发现网络带宽利用率较低,通过分析流量分布,发现部分应用占用带宽较高。企业针对这些应用进行优化,提高了网络带宽利用率。
总之,虚拟网络流量采集的数据分析方法在网络安全、网络优化、网络监控等领域具有广泛的应用前景。随着网络技术的不断发展,虚拟网络流量采集的数据分析方法也将不断进步,为网络领域的发展提供有力支持。
猜你喜欢:OpenTelemetry